Gospel, Certainty and History
Luke 1:1-4 | EV Night | 9/02/2025 | Andrew Heard
The gospel of Luke is a carefully researched and investigated account of Jesus' life and ministry. Andrew Heard challenges us to see that the certainty of the Christian message points to reasoned and rational response of faith in Jesus.

Daniel - a foreginer and exile
Daniel 7:1-14 | EV Church | 20/07/2025 | Andrew Heard
Andrew Heard leads us through Daniel 7, a chapter filled with vivid dreams and powerful visions. In a world where chaos can feel in control, we're reminded that God still reigns. We're encouraged to read the Old Testament through the lens of Christ, to stay prayerful and alert, and to remember that God's delay is not inaction, but mercy - holding the door open for salvation.

Religious rituals don't save. Faith in Jesus does.
Colossians 2:16-23 | EV Church | 6/10/2024 | Andrew Hayes
Everyone wants to grow - or we should! But how? Colossians 2:16-23 raises the dangers of seeking growth through human traditions, rules, or mystical practices, which sound helpful but can actually be harmful. In Colossians, Paul shows us that Jesus gives us all we need for salvation and growth, and we see how it is that he grows us. Are you giving yourself to the normal ways that Jesus grows you?
